The New York Times:
The New York Times is often considered a newspaper of record, and while it strives for objectivity, its news coverage generally leans left. The editorial board is decidedly liberal, and the paper often publishes in-depth investigations into social and economic inequality. The NYT excels in investigative journalism and comprehensive reporting, but it sometimes faces criticism for its perceived elitism and focus on national and international issues, potentially overshadowing local stories. Its strength lies in its ability to set the agenda for other news organizations. It's a must-read if you want to stay informed about major events and policy debates, even if you don't always agree with its perspective. For instance, their coverage of climate change is extensive, often highlighting the urgency of the issue and the need for government action. Their reporting on economic policy frequently examines the impact on different socioeconomic groups, emphasizing the need for policies that reduce inequality. They delve deeply into issues like healthcare, education, and criminal justice reform, providing detailed analysis and diverse viewpoints.

The Washington Post:
Similar to The New York Times, The Washington Post is another leading national newspaper with a left-leaning bent. Known for its investigative journalism, particularly its coverage of Watergate, The Post offers in-depth reporting on politics, policy, and social issues. The Post is recognized for its strong investigative journalism and political coverage, but it can sometimes be perceived as catering to a Washington D.C. elite audience. It distinguishes itself through its local reporting on the D.C. metro area, providing valuable insights into local politics and community issues. Their coverage of government and politics is extensive, offering detailed analysis and holding public officials accountable. They also focus on social issues, such as racial justice, gender equality, and LGBTQ+ rights, providing a platform for diverse voices and perspectives.

The Guardian:
The Guardian is a British newspaper with a strong international presence and a clear left-leaning perspective. It emphasizes social justice, human rights, and environmental issues. The Guardian is noted for its in-depth reporting on social and environmental issues, but it can sometimes be perceived as overly idealistic or preachy. Its strength lies in its investigative journalism and its commitment to holding power accountable. Their coverage of climate change is extensive, often highlighting the urgency of the issue and the need for global action. They also focus on human rights abuses and social inequalities around the world, giving voice to marginalized communities.

Understanding the Left-Leaning Media Landscape
Before we jump into specific outlets, let’s clarify what we mean by "left-leaning." Generally, these news sources emphasize social justice, equality, and government intervention to address societal problems. They often advocate for policies such as universal healthcare, environmental protection, and stronger labor protections. These outlets typically offer critical perspectives on conservative policies and politicians, and they tend to amplify the voices of marginalized groups.
